Commenting on the markets, Mike Prentis, representing the Investment Manager noted:
During May the Company's NAV per share rose by 5.8% on a capital only basis whilst the benchmark index rose by 3.9%; the FTSE 100 Index rose by 0.7%. Outperformance was derived from mainly from stock selection but sector allocation and gearing also contributed.
The major positive contributors to stock selection during the month were our holdings in Topps Tiles and Savills. Topps Tiles announced interim results showing like-for-like revenue growth of 5.3% and earnings per share growth of 14%.Trading remains good and management were on confident form when we met them. Savills held their AGM and indicated that trading was slightly ahead of expectations and substantially ahead of the corresponding period in 2014.
The largest detractor from relative outperformance during the month was, for the second month running, Northbridge Industrial Services. Northbridge is being impacted by the decline in the oil price. This is affecting their loadbank rental operations in Singapore and Dubai, and their oil tools business in Australia. Forecasts have been substantially reduced.
Turning to sector allocation, our overweight position in housebuilders and household goods was positive.
We added a holding in SSP Group, a leading operator of food and beverage outlets in travel outlets worldwide. The holding was taken in a placing during which SSP's private equity backers sold their remaining stake. SSP is a significant business which recently reported interim revenues of £859 million, like-for-like revenue growth of 3.0%, and operating profits up 35% at £25 million.
